
























This paper introduces and explores the idea of data poisoning, a light-weight peer-architecture technique to inject faults into Python programs. This method requires very small modification to the original program, which facilitates evaluation of sensitivity of systems that are prototyped or modeled in Python. We propose different fault scenarios that can be injected to programs using data poisoning. We use Dijkstra's Self Stabilizing Ring Algorithm to illustrate the approach.
